For R-4 : Ms.A.Banumathy * * * C O M M O N O R D E R Heard both sides.
2. The case on hand pertains to the affairs of Antharanachiamman temple, Kottaiyiruppu, Thiruppathur Taluk. The temple building has become quite old and dilapidated. 3/8
4 W.P.(MD)NO.19656 OF 2025 Renovation was proposed to be held. Hence, the deity was shifted and placed in Balalayam. But on account of the factional disputes, Kumbabishekam could not be conducted. And quite a few cases were filed.
3. While so, the Tahsildar, Thirupathur vide order dated 04.06.2025 directed that Kumbabishekam should be performed within three months. Challenging the same, Neelmegam filed W.P. (MD)No.19656 of 2025. For enforcing the said order, Kodeeswaran filed W.P.(MD)No.24013 of 2025.
4. Both the writ petitioners belong to the same community(Adhi Dravidar community).
5. Considering the said aspect, the following directions are issued:- a) Since the deity has been kept in Balalayam for more than a year, it is not proper to continue such an arrangement any further. For this reason, the deity shall be shifted back to the temple tomorrow. "Ganapathy Homam" 4/8
5 W.P.(MD)NO.19656 OF 2025 alone shall be performed and there will not be any elaborate rituals. All the four temple priests (Thiru.Chidambaram, Thiru.Shanmugavel, Thiru.Karthi and Thiru.Chandran) will be involved. If Chidambaram who appears to be with Neelamegam is not willing to be a part of the event, he will not be compelled. Whether to participate in tomorrow's "Ganapathy Homam" or not is left to Chidambaram's discretion and choice.
b) Thiruppani committee shall be constituted within two weeks. The committee shall have equal representation (3 + 3) from Kodeeswaran side as well as Neelamegam side. Six members will be constituted. c) Since the temple has become quite dilapidated, the existing structure will be dismantled. The temple structure shall be dismantled immediately after Deepavali, in the first week of November, 2025.
d) A new temple shall be constructed and Kumbabishekam will be performed within a period of three months, thereafter.
e) Kumbabishekam will be held under the aegis of 5/8
6 W.P.(MD)NO.19656 OF 2025 the Tahsildar, Thirupathur Taluk.
f) No person shall be given any first honour or privileges.
g) A common note book shall be maintained and contribution shall be received from any devotee. The expenditure for Kumbabishekam shall be met out of the funds generated for that purpose. It will not be called as Head Tax(Thalaikattu Vari).
h) The jurisdictional police is directed to close all the pending complaints. Shri. Neelamegam fairly comes forward to withdraw the complaint given to HR&CE Department and the said complaint shall also be closed by the Joint Commissioner, HR&CE Department, Thirupathur.
